A Transportation Plan for the Full Celebration

A quinceañera itinerary often connects several important locations, each with a firm time. The quinceañera may need a quiet family pickup, an on-time church arrival, a photo session at a permitted location, and a coordinated entrance with the court at the reception. A vehicle that arrives at only one segment can solve a ride, but a planned itinerary protects the day.

Royal Elite begins with the ceremony and reception times, then works backward to establish realistic pickups. Add loading time for gowns, formalwear, bouquets, gifts, and family photographs. If the church, portrait location, or ballroom has a special commercial-vehicle entrance, share the instructions before service.

Families can reserve one vehicle for the quinceañera and court, or divide the transportation:

  • a luxury sedan or SUV for the quinceañera and parents;
  • a stretch limousine for a smaller court;
  • a Sprinter or party bus for damas and chambelanes;
  • an executive SUV for grandparents or family members needing a quieter ride; and
  • a minibus for guest or hotel shuttles.

One family coordinator should hold the final passenger list, route, time windows, and dispatch information. That person can communicate approved adjustments without conflicting directions from several relatives.

Choose Your Quinceañera Vehicle

Vehicle class Typical capacity Ideal use Space considerations
Luxury sedan 1–3 passengers Quinceañera with one or two parents; elegant photo arrival Limited luggage; gown volume matters
Executive SUV Up to about 5–6 Immediate family, padrinos, or VIP relatives More entry room and cargo flexibility than a sedan
Stretch limousine Up to about 8–10 Quinceañera and a smaller court Ask about door access, gown comfort, and storage
Limo-style Sprinter About 10–14 Medium court of honor or family group Confirm seating layout and step-in height
SUV/super-stretch limousine About 12–20 A larger court seeking a limousine-style entrance Local availability is limited; exact capacity varies
Small/medium party bus About 20–30 Full court plus family or friends Better group movement; confirm loading access and storage
Large party bus About 36–40 Very large court or combined celebration group Requires legal loading space and a suitable route
Minibus About 18–35 Guest shuttle, hotel loop, or transportation-first use Often better for forward-facing seating and baggage needs

Capacity is a legal limit, not a comfort target. A gown, suits, coats, flowers, and personal items can make the maximum feel crowded. If the party includes exactly the advertised number of passengers, ask whether moving up one class is practical.

Vehicle photos are representative unless the agreement identifies the assigned vehicle. Do not assume every limousine or party bus has the same lighting, bar setup, audio connection, seat belts, restroom, or entry configuration. Confirm essential features and accessibility before paying.

Sample Quinceañera Transportation Timeline

Every family has its own ceremony and traditions. This sample shows how to protect travel and photography time without dictating the celebration itself.

Time Transportation step Planning note
1:30 p.m. Vehicle arrives at family pickup Allow time for gown entry and family photographs
2:00 p.m. Depart for church or ceremony Include traffic and a calm arrival buffer
3:30 p.m. Depart ceremony Identify the legal loading point in advance
4:00 p.m. Portrait location Obtain photography and vehicle-access permission
5:30 p.m. Travel to reception Coordinate court and family vehicles
6:00 p.m. Grand entrance staging Confirm whether the vehicle waits or is released
10:30 p.m. Planned return service Provide every approved drop-off before the event

Avoid trying to schedule every minute. Downtown traffic, a ceremony that runs long, or an extended photo session can change the day. Ask how waiting and overtime are billed, then add a sensible buffer to the reservation.

For multiple homes, consider one central court pickup. It reduces time spent loading at narrow residential streets and helps the court arrive together. If separate pickups are essential, list each address in route order before the quote.

Transportation for the Court of Honor

The court may include damas, chambelanes, siblings, cousins, and friends. Confirm who is riding during each segment; the church-to-photo list may not be the same as the reception-to-home list. A written manifest helps the family coordinator know that the group is accounted for without collecting unnecessary personal information.

Before choosing a vehicle, answer these questions:

  • How many court members will ride?
  • Will parents or attendants ride with them?
  • Does everyone need transportation to every stop?
  • How much space will gowns, suits, flowers, and personal items require?
  • Is there one pickup or several?
  • Can a large vehicle legally load at the home, church, and venue?
  • Is a celebratory interior important, or is shuttle efficiency the priority?

For minors, the responsible booking adult should review authorization, conduct, alcohol, and emergency-contact requirements. Underage alcohol and illegal substances are prohibited. The chauffeur must follow the approved itinerary and cannot accept unsafe or unauthorized requests from passengers.

What Affects Quinceañera Transportation Pricing?

  • Number and class of vehicles
  • Total passenger count and how the group is divided
  • Service hours and minimums
  • Pickup city and local inventory
  • Distance between home, church, portrait site, reception, and returns
  • Multiple residential pickups and drop-offs
  • Waiting during the ceremony or reception
  • Parking, tolls, permits, and venue access
  • Weekend, holiday, prom/wedding season, and special-event demand
  • Approved decorations or setup time
  • Gratuity, taxes, and market surcharges when applicable
  • Overtime, added stops, cleaning, or damage

If the vehicle waits through the reception, compare that cost with a split transfer or return pickup. Availability and garage travel may make one option more practical than the other.

Family Planning and Safety

Confirm the adults responsible for the reservation

Name one primary family coordinator and a backup. Royal Elite may require parent or guardian authorization for minors and may ask the booking customer to accept responsibility for the group.

Approve the complete route

Give reservations the full addresses, venue contact instructions, and drop-off plan. Drivers cannot improvise illegal loading or accept unapproved destinations that conflict with the agreement.

Protect the schedule

Build in time for gown entry, photographs, ceremony release, traffic, and reception staging. Tell the photographer and planner the contracted transportation window.

Ask before decorating

Fresh flowers or a removable sign may be possible with approval. Adhesives, glitter, confetti, open flames, sharp attachments, and anything that blocks windows, exits, or safety equipment may be prohibited. Never attach decorations without written permission.

Review conduct and cleaning terms

No underage alcohol is permitted. Smoking, illegal substances, dangerous behavior, and vehicle damage are prohibited. Food and beverages require approval. The booking party can be responsible for excessive cleaning or damage under the contract.
